Transaction 35d38aeb6903bbee20ab023fde14a671a9090be7e4920709639c2156764cf125

2 Input
2 Outputs
  • 35d38aeb6903bbee20ab023fde14a671a9090be7e4920709639c2156764cf125:0
  • value  43200000
    address  13upf8Z6xqRjriMauD7iK7kyPbigRpNYZk
  • 35d38aeb6903bbee20ab023fde14a671a9090be7e4920709639c2156764cf125:1
  • value  1590000
    address  15gY52QmV7gNpppdbTgWX2MPriFxhquNCT